Transponder keys are car key that has an anti-theft security measure in it. This is accomplished by incorporating an RFID chip to identify radio frequencies into the head of the key. This chip is used to relay a signal to the immobilizer system in your vehicle during the ignition startup process. This chip stops hot-wiring and makes it very difficult to take an automobile. It isn't to say that transponder keys are secure as although they provide an extra layer of security it does not mean that criminals is unable to employ their skills to gain entry into the vehicle. It just means that it takes them longer and more effort to do it and that's why this security feature is a huge advantage for anyone who cares about the safety of their vehicles. Transponder keys are easy to use. The microchip inside the plastic head of the key is programmed with a unique serial number that is connected to the immobilizer system that is in your vehicle. The immobilizer system will check the serial number when you put the key in the ignition. If the serial number is in line the engine will begin. What is the process to program a transponder key? A car key that has a chip in it is a type of transponder key. They are designed to stop auto theft by ensuring that only the correct key is used to start the car. A locksmith can program a new key for you if you've lost yours, or if the chip is damaged in any way. In most cases the process of programming a chip key is relatively simple and straightforward. However, some vehicles require special equipment to program the key. The first step in the process is to determine what kind of key you have. To ensure that you have the correct key blank it is important to know your vehicle's model, make and year. Some keys have the transponder inside the head of the key, while others don't. If your key has a chip, the bow cover will be more hefty. You can also tell whether your keys are equipped with chips by examining the ignition. If it has a push to start button instead of a key hole, it is probably one equipped with chip. After you have a suitable key blank, the next step is to determine which method of programming will be used. Some transponder keys are programmed with on-board diagnostics, while others require a specialized key programming device. The key programming device must be compatible with the key circuitboard or transponder that is being used. It must also operate at the same frequency as the car's computer onboard. Transponder keys typically have an antenna ring on their head that transmits radio frequency energy to a chip within. The chip then responds by sending an identification code to the antenna ring. Once the transmission is received, the ignition system can detect that the key has been placed in the key and turn on.
